Personal tools

Practica interpretarii monadice

From HaskellWiki

(Difference between revisions)
Jump to: navigation, search
Line 4: Line 4:
   
 
'''Sunt prezentate: '''
 
'''Sunt prezentate: '''
  +
<br>- O clasificare a interpretoarelor care ne permite sa alegem tipul interpretoarelor pe care le vom implementa
 
<br>- Un back-end monadic
 
<br>- Un back-end monadic
<br>- Parserele modulare pentru expresiile din limbaj
+
<br>- Parserele modulare pentru expresiile din limbaj incluzand gramatica expresiilor.
<br>- Parserele modulare pentru comenzile din limbaj
+
<br>- Parserele modulare pentru comenzile din limbaj incluzand gramatica comenzilor.
 
<br>- Combinarea front-end-ului cu back-end-ul
 
<br>- Combinarea front-end-ului cu back-end-ul
 
<br>- Adaugarea de instructiuni complexe, fie ca sunt abordate cu tehnici semantice (prin modificarea back-end-ului monadic) fie ca sunt abordate cu tehnici sintactice (rescriere de arbori)
 
<br>- Adaugarea de instructiuni complexe, fie ca sunt abordate cu tehnici semantice (prin modificarea back-end-ului monadic) fie ca sunt abordate cu tehnici sintactice (rescriere de arbori)
<br>
+
<br>- Capturi de ecran ilustrand functionarea programelor
  +
<br>- Anexe: sursele complete, o biblioteca de combinatori de parsere comentata, etc
   
   
 
'''Sunt incluse:'''<br>
 
'''Sunt incluse:'''<br>
<br>- Exercitii si probhleme la fiecare capitol
+
<br>- Exercitii si probleme la fiecare capitol
  +
* Descarcati o pagina cu Exercitii din Cap 5 - Draft din 26 dec 2007
 
<br>- Fragmente de studiu de caz
 
<br>- Fragmente de studiu de caz
   
(19.ian.2008)
+
(19.ian.2008-14iunie 2008)
 
----
 
----
 
Pagina indexata la indexul [[Category:Ro]] [http://www.haskell.org/haskellwiki/Category:Ro Categories:Ro]
 
Pagina indexata la indexul [[Category:Ro]] [http://www.haskell.org/haskellwiki/Category:Ro Categories:Ro]

Revision as of 12:47, 19 June 2008


Volumul Practica interpretarii monadice isi propune sa prezinte aplicarea cunostintelor de limbaje formale (gramatici in special) la constructia interpretoarelor.

Sunt prezentate:
- O clasificare a interpretoarelor care ne permite sa alegem tipul interpretoarelor pe care le vom implementa
- Un back-end monadic
- Parserele modulare pentru expresiile din limbaj incluzand gramatica expresiilor.
- Parserele modulare pentru comenzile din limbaj incluzand gramatica comenzilor.
- Combinarea front-end-ului cu back-end-ul
- Adaugarea de instructiuni complexe, fie ca sunt abordate cu tehnici semantice (prin modificarea back-end-ului monadic) fie ca sunt abordate cu tehnici sintactice (rescriere de arbori)
- Capturi de ecran ilustrand functionarea programelor
- Anexe: sursele complete, o biblioteca de combinatori de parsere comentata, etc


Sunt incluse:

- Exercitii si probleme la fiecare capitol

  • Descarcati o pagina cu Exercitii din Cap 5 - Draft din 26 dec 2007


- Fragmente de studiu de caz

(19.ian.2008-14iunie 2008)


Pagina indexata la indexul Categories:Ro


<= Inapoi la pagina principala Ro/Haskell.

<- Inapoi la inceputul paginii 'Intrebarile incepatorului Ro/Haskell'.